Paula Cynthia Jones <librarianjones@YAHOO.COM> wrote: Hi all, Thanks so much for the HUGE outpouring of support with my filtering problems. I received many many replies both on and off the list. I have not yet sent personal thank yous to all who helped but I plan to do so soon. (My apologies in advance if I miss anyone.) We had a fairly productive meeting Monday after school. The assistant superintendent was there as was the director of technology, my principal and three teacher's association representatives. I was able to explain what I believe to be the major problems with the current situation. Everyone listened nicely. I believe I really got their attention, though, when I passed around the handouts I had prepared using many ideas from members of this list. I think I really floored our interim assistant superintendent (whom I had not met) because I offered solutions in addition to complaints. A study committee is being formed to construct a board policy on staff use of technology. This should shift some of the responsibility away from the filters (I'm hoping.) Also, in case I didn't explain previously, the person doing the filtering and the e-mail reading is a technician, not the technology director. The director is going to reprimand the technician and direct him to allow many more messages through the filter. We will be meeting again in early April so I will undoubtedly be asking this list for more help in the future. Thanks again for all of the help and support. It's so nice to know I'm not alone!
